What does the 'probe' do in VCS?

Weird question I know, but I'm intrigued.

Say for instance you have an Application in an SG with the usual start/stop/monitor. To successfully probe does it just check for existence of the script/file ?

Thanks...

From VCS doc, to check a resource whether it is configured and ready to be brought online.